#f39def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f39def is composed of 95.3% red, 61.6%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 1.6%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 302.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 78.4%. #f39def color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e73bdf.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

#f39def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f39def has RGB values of R:243, G:157,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.02,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15965679.

Hex triplet f39def #f39def
RGB Decimal 243, 157, 239 rgb(243,157,239)
RGB Percent 95.3, 61.6, 93.7 rgb(95.3%,61.6%,93.7%)
CMYK 0, 35, 2, 5
HSL 302.8°, 78.2, 78.4 hsl(302.8,78.2%,78.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 302.8°, 35.4, 95.3
Web Safe ff99ff #ff99ff
CIE-LAB 75.701, 44.34, -28.042
XYZ 64.597, 49.403, 87.79
xyY 0.32, 0.245, 49.403
CIE-LCH 75.701, 52.463, 327.69
CIE-LUV 75.701, 43.173, -51.58
Hunter-Lab 70.287, 41.048, -24.853
Binary 11110011, 10011101, 11101111

Shades and Tints of #f39def

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070107 is the darkest color, while #fef4fd is the lightest one.
